FUNCTIONAL DESCRIPTION (continued)
DATA PROTECTION (continued)
2. Data protection at Vcc on/off.
When RES\ is low, the EEPROM cannot be erased and
programmed. Therefore, data can be protected by keeping
RES\ low when Vcc is switched. RES\ should be high during
programming because it does not provide a latch function.
When Vcc is turned on or off, noise on the control pins
generated by external circuits (CPU, etc.) may turn the
EEPROM to programming mode by mistake. To prevent
this unintentional programming, the EEPROM must be kept
in an unprogrammable, standby or readout state by using a
CPU reset signal to RES\ pin.
In addition, when RES\ is kept high at Vcc on/off timing,
the input level of control pins (CE\, OE\, WE\) must be held
as CE\=Vcc or OE\=LOW or WE\=Vcc level.
3. Software Data Protection
To protect against unintentional programming caused by
noise generated by external circuits, AS58C1001 has a
Software data protection function. To initate Software data
protection mode, 3 bytes of data must be input, followed by
a dummy write cycle of any address and any data byte. This
exact sequence switches the device into protection mode.
The Software data protection mode can be cancelled by
inputting the following 6 Bytes. This changes the AS58C1001
to the Non-Protection mode, for normal operation.
